Always turn off hyphenation; it makes .\" way too many mistakes in technical documents. .if n .ad l .nh .SH "NAME" SplitTextFiles.pl \- Split CSV or TSV TextFile(s) into multiple text files .SH "SYNOPSIS" .IX Header "SYNOPSIS" SplitTextFiles.pl TextFile(s)... .PP SplitTextFiles.pl [\fB\-f, \-\-fast\fR] [\fB\-h, \-\-help\fR] [\fB\-\-indelim\fR comma | semicolon] [\fB\-l, \-\-label\fR yes | no] [\fB\-n, \-\-numfiles\fR number] [\fB\-o, \-\-overwrite\fR] [\fB\-\-outdelim\fR comma | tab | semicolon] [\fB\-q, \-\-quote\fR yes | no] [\fB\-r, \-\-root\fR rootname] [\fB\-w, \-\-workingdir\fR dirname] TextFile(s)... .SH "DESCRIPTION" .IX Header "DESCRIPTION" Split \s-1CSV\s0 or \s-1TSV\s0 \fITextFile(s)\fR into multiple text files. Each new text file contains a subset of similar number of lines from the initial file. The file names are separated by space. The valid file extensions are \fI.csv\fR and \fI.tsv\fR for comma/semicolon and tab delimited text files respectively. All other file names are ignored. All the text files in a current directory can be specified by \fI*.csv\fR, \fI*.tsv\fR, or the current directory name. The \fB\-\-indelim\fR option determines the format of \fITextFile(s)\fR. Any file which doesn't correspond to the format indicated by \fB\-\-indelim\fR option is ignored. .SH "OPTIONS" .IX Header "OPTIONS" .IP "\fB\-f, \-\-fast\fR" 4 .IX Item "-f, --fast" In this mode, \fB\-\-indelim, \-\-outdelim\fR, and \fB\-q \-\-quote\fR options are ignored. The format of input and output file(s) are assumed to be similar. And the text lines from input \fITextFile(s)\fR are just transferred to output file(s) without any processing. .IP "\fB\-h, \-\-help\fR" 4 .IX Item "-h, --help" Print this help message. .IP "\fB\-\-indelim\fR \fIcomma | semicolon\fR" 4 .IX Item "--indelim comma | semicolon" Input delimiter for \s-1CSV\s0 \fITextFile(s)\fR. Possible values: \fIcomma or semicolon\fR. Default value: \fIcomma\fR. For \s-1TSV\s0 files, this option is ignored and \fItab\fR is used as a delimiter. .IP "\fB\-l, \-\-label\fR \fIyes | no\fR" 4 .IX Item "-l, --label yes | no" First line contains column labels. Possible values: \fIyes or no\fR. Default value: \fIyes\fR. .IP "\fB\-n, \-\-numfiles\fR \fInumber\fR" 4 .IX Item "-n, --numfiles number" Number of new files to generate for each TextFile(s). Default: \fI2\fR. .IP "\fB\-o, \-\-overwrite\fR" 4 .IX Item "-o, --overwrite" Overwrite existing files. .IP "\fB\-\-outdelim\fR \fIcomma | tab | semicolon\fR" 4 .IX Item "--outdelim comma | tab | semicolon" Output text file delimiter. Possible values: \fIcomma, tab, or semicolon\fR. Default value: \fIcomma\fR .IP "\fB\-q, \-\-quote\fR \fIyes | no\fR" 4 .IX Item "-q, --quote yes | no" Put quotes around column values in output text file. Possible values: \fIyes or no\fR. Default value: \fIyes\fR. .IP "\fB\-r, \-\-root\fR \fIrootname\fR" 4 .IX Item "-r, --root rootname" New text file names are generated using the root: <Root>Part<Count>.<Ext>. Default new file names: <InitialTextFileName>Part<Count>.<Ext>. The csv, and tsv <Ext> values are used for comma/semicolon, and tab delimited text files respectively.This option is ignored for multiple input files. .IP "\fB\-w, \-\-workingdir\fR \fIdirname\fR" 4 .IX Item "-w, --workingdir dirname" Location of working directory. Default: current directory. .SH "EXAMPLES" .IX Header "EXAMPLES" To split each \s-1CSV\s0 text files into 4 different text files type: .PP .Vb 2 \& % SplitTextFiles.pl \-n 5 \-o Sample1.csv Sample2.csv \& % SplitTextFiles.pl \-n 5 \-o *.csv .Ve .PP To split Sample1.tsv into 10 different \s-1CSV\s0 text files, type: .PP .Vb 1 \& % SplitTextFiles.pl \-n 10 \-\-outdelim comma \-o Sample1.tsv .Ve .SH "AUTHOR" .IX Header "AUTHOR" Manish Sud <msud@san.rr.com> .SH "SEE ALSO" .IX Header "SEE ALSO" JoinTextFiles.pl, MergeTextFiles.pl, ModifyTextFilesFormat.pl .SH "COPYRIGHT" .IX Header "COPYRIGHT" Copyright (C) 2015 Manish Sud.
